What Are Freestyle Trap Beats?

To comprehend the importance of freestyle trap beats, it's necessary to first break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In basic terms, a freestyle beat is an crucial track that is made for musicians to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's meant to inspire off-the-cuff performances, urging rappers to provide spontaneous and frequently a lot more raw, impulsive verses.

A freestyle type beat differs a little from a regular instrumental in that it's structured in a manner that provides artists room to take a breath. These beats usually have less melodic components, leaving space for complex circulations and powerful wordplay. They're likewise usually a lot more repetitive than conventional song instrumentals, ensuring that the rap artist or singer can easily find their groove and ride the beat without obtaining shed in complicated setups.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the realm of freestyle beats, there is a specific part called fre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, stemming from the southerly USA, is identified by big use 808 bass drums, fast h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able tunes. It's a sound that has expanded in popularity throughout the years, becoming one of one of the most prominent styles in modern-day r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ature elements and fuse them with the liberty and adaptability of freestyle beats, leading to a effective combo. These beats are best for musicians aiming to bring energy and aggression to their knowledgeables while still keeping the flexibility to explore different circulations and designs.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Representation

Amongst the many variants of freestyle trap beats, the DaBaby type beat has actually become one of the most in-demand. DaBaby type beats are influenced by the trademark sound of the North Carolina rap artist DaBaby, understood for his speedy distribution, catchy hooks, and compelling manufacturing. These beats commonly include fast paces,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ile tunes, making them best for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So Well for Freestyles

1. Fast Tempos: The quick rate of a DaBaby type beat urges rappers to provide rapid-fire flows, forcing them to think on their feet and press their lyrical boundaries.

2. Simple Yet Memorable Tunes: Unlike some trap beats that can be excessively intricate, DaBaby type beats are frequently developed around easy, repetitive melodies that leave area for the rapper's vocals to shine.

3. Compelling Drums: The hostile percussion in these beats adds an aspect of necessity, driving the musician to match the beat's strength with their lyrics.

Whether you're a fan of DaBaby's songs or otherwise, there's no rejecting the influence his sound has had on modern-day freestyle culture. The DaBaby type beat is a staple in the freestyle beat planet, offering artists a platform to display their speed, accuracy, and personal appeal.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ers give totally free usage, usually for non-commercial purposes. While the beats can be made use of for trials, freestyles, and social media sites web content, musicians typically need to pay for a permit if they want to launch the tune commercially (i.e., on streaming systems or up for sale).

This model has actually been a game-changer, enabling young musicians to experiment with their sound, exercise their freestyling, and build an on-line presence without needing to worry about manufacturing prices.
